Kindred at Home Hope, AR Receives CMS 4.5-Star Rating for Quality of Patient Care

Hope, AR (January 31, 2020) – Kindred at Home Hope, AR is pleased to announce it has earned a 4.5 Star rating for quality of patient care from the national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services (CMS).

The quality of patient care rating is based on OASIS assessments and Medicare claims data that measure eight key processes or outcomes related to patient care. The results are available on Home Health Compare, CMS’s public information website that provides information on how well Medicare-certified agencies provide care to their patients. Agencies are rated periodically – from one to five stars – with top performers earning the coveted 5-star rating.

The Home Health Compare site allows users to select multiple agencies at a time to assess home health agencies’ performance on the eight quality measures as well as a separate measure based upon patient survey results. The quality measures include: timely initiation of care; drug education on all medications provided to patient/caregiver, improvement in ambulation, improvement in bed transferring, improvement in bathing, improvement in pain interfering with activity, improvement in shortness of breath, and reduced acute care hospitalization.
